The presence of a bone island, also known as enostosis, is generally considered a benign incidental finding on imaging studies such as X-rays, CT scans, or MRIs. These dense, localized areas of compact bone are usually asymptomatic and discovered unexpectedly during evaluations for unrelated issues. However, your concern about when to truly become vigilant is very valid. Understanding when a bone island warrants further attention hinges on several factors, including symptoms, imaging characteristics, and individual health history.
Firstly, bone islands are overwhelmingly asymptomatic. If you experience localized pain, swelling, or any unexplained orthopedic symptoms in the area where the bone island is visualized, it is prudent to seek further evaluation. Pain or changes around the lesion could indicate complications like a fracture, or more concerningly, a pathological process mimicking a bone island.
Differentiating a typical bone island from more sinister pathologies is a key step. Bone islands usually appear as small, homogenously dense areas with well-defined margins, often stable over time. Advanced imaging techniques, like CT scans, provide clearer visualization with no aggressive features such as cortical destruction or surrounding soft tissue involvement. By contrast, malignant bone lesions tend to be larger, exhibit irregular borders, and demonstrate growth on serial imaging.
Individual health history plays an important role. Those with a history of cancer (especially primary bone tumors or metastases) or systemic bone conditions should approach even incidental findings with more caution, often warranting further imaging follow-up or biopsy for definitive exclusion of malignancy.
To navigate the uncertainty surrounding bone islands, doctors combine clinical context with imaging findings. Patients should maintain open communication with their healthcare providers to understand the nature of the lesion and the rationale for monitoring or additional testing. Generally, periodic imaging follow-up is sufficient, scanning for changes over time rather than immediate alarm.
Proactive measures can include maintaining bone health through proper nutrition, weight-bearing exercise, and managing underlying health conditions that affect bone density. Staying informed empowers patients to recognize red flags such as new symptoms or rapid changes on subsequent scans.
In conclusion, while bone islands are typically harmless, vigilance is warranted when accompanied by symptoms, atypical imaging features, or relevant medical history. Striking a balance between awareness and unnecessary anxiety involves trusting professional guidance, monitoring appropriately, and fostering informed dialogue with healthcare providers. This approach ensures peace of mind while safeguarding skeletal health in a thoughtful, evidence-based manner.
